
Senior Scientific and Technical Advisor at Lambiotte where he was Director of Research and Development since 1990 till his retirement in 2021. He has developed the knowledge on acetals and their uses in various fields, including aerosols, fuels, amino resins ... He received a BSc and a MSc Degree in 1977. Till 1983 he did a PhD study in the Department of Organic Chemistry of the University of Louvain-la-Neuve in Belgium. He worked on iminium salts chemistry, organometallic chemistry and the chemistry of free radicals. In 1984, he occupied a position at the Feinberg Graduate School of the Weizmann Institute of Science in the Department of Neurobiology and the Department of Organic Chemistry, working on the chemistry of kainic acid and of heterocyclic and organophosphorous compounds. In 1987, he was assistant Professor at the Department of Organic Chemistry of the University of Namur (Belgium), where he worked on selenium and beryllium chemistry. In 1989, he was researcher at the Department of Pharmacy of the University of Louvain-en-Woluwe (Belgium), where he worked on penicillins.
